Key Insights

  • The considerable ownership by private companies in Zhejiang Zhaolong Interconnect TechnologyLtd indicates that they collectively have a greater say in management and business strategy
  • 59% of the business is held by the top 2 shareholders
  • Insider ownership in Zhejiang Zhaolong Interconnect TechnologyLtd is 24%

Every investor in Zhejiang Zhaolong Interconnect Technology Co.,Ltd. (SZSE:300913) should be aware of the most powerful shareholder groups. With 50% stake, private companies possess the maximum shares in the company. Put another way, the group faces the maximum upside potential (or downside risk).

Following a 7.4% increase in the stock price last week, private companies profited the most, but insiders who own 24% stock also stood to gain from the increase.

Hedge funds don't have many shares in Zhejiang Zhaolong Interconnect TechnologyLtd. Our data shows that Zhejiang Zhaolong Holding Co., Ltd. is the largest shareholder with 45% of shares outstanding. With 15% and 4.9% of the shares outstanding respectively, Jinlong Yao and Yinlong Yao are the second and third largest shareholders. Two of the top three shareholders happen to be Chief Executive Officer and Member of the Board of Directors, respectively. That is, insiders feature higher up in the heirarchy of the company's top shareholders.

After doing some more digging, we found that the top 2 shareholders collectively control more than half of the company's shares, implying that they have considerable power to influence the company's decisions.

Insider Ownership Of Zhejiang Zhaolong Interconnect TechnologyLtd

The definition of an insider can differ slightly between different countries, but members of the board of directors always count. Company management run the business, but the CEO will answer to the board, even if he or she is a member of it.

Insider ownership is positive when it signals leadership are thinking like the true owners of the company. However, high insider ownership can also give immense power to a small group within the company. This can be negative in some circumstances.

Our information suggests that insiders maintain a significant holding in Zhejiang Zhaolong Interconnect Technology Co.,Ltd.. It has a market capitalization of just CN¥6.8b, and insiders have CN¥1.7b worth of shares in their own names. We would say this shows alignment with shareholders, but it is worth noting that the company is still quite small; some insiders may have founded the business. General Public Ownership

The general public-- including retail investors -- own 21% stake in the company, and hence can't easily be ignored. While this size of ownership may not be enough to sway a policy decision in their favour, they can still make a collective impact on company policies.

Private Company Ownership

Our data indicates that Private Companies hold 50%, of the company's shares. It's hard to draw any conclusions from this fact alone, so its worth looking into who owns those private companies. Sometimes insiders or other related parties have an interest in shares in a public company through a separate private company.
